QMC study of trapped Bose-Bose mixtures at finite temperature

We present our recent study [1] of thermal properties of a trapped Bose-Bose mixture in a dilute regime using quantum Monte Carlo methods. We have investigated the dependence of the superfluid density and the condensate fraction on temperature, for the mixed and separated phases. To this end, we have used the path-integral Monte Carlo method for finite temperatures and the diffusion Monte Carlo method, in the zero-temperature limit, comparing the obtained results with solutions of the coupled Gross-Pitaevskii equations. We notice anisotropy of superfluid density in some phase-separated mixtures. Our results also show that the superfluid density and condensate fraction have slightly different temperature evolution, showing noteworthy situations where the superfluid fraction is smaller than the condensate fraction.
